Patek Philippe Complications Moonphase: A Symphony of Functions
The Complications collection showcases Patek Philippe's mastery of complex horological functions. Within this prestigious line, several models incorporate the lunar phase display, often alongside other sophisticated complications such as annual calendars, perpetual calendars, or chronographs. The watch mentioned in the introductory paragraph, the Complications 5205G, exemplifies this approach. Its white gold case, black leather strap, and two-tone dial create a refined and elegant aesthetic, while the annual calendar and moon phase functions provide a practical and visually engaging display of time. The interplay of these complications highlights Patek Philippe's ability to seamlessly blend functionality with artistic expression. The meticulously crafted movement, visible through the sapphire crystal caseback in many models, reveals the intricate dance of gears and levers that bring this celestial display to life. These watches are not mere timekeepers; they are intricate mechanical masterpieces, meticulously assembled by highly skilled artisans.
Patek Philippe Nautilus Moonphase: A Subaquatic Celestial Encounter
The Nautilus, a design icon of the 20th century, has undergone several iterations, with some featuring the captivating lunar phase complication. The combination of the Nautilus' sporty yet sophisticated design with the romantic charm of the moon phase creates a unique and compelling juxtaposition. The integration of the moon phase into the Nautilus's robust case, often crafted from stainless steel or precious metals, highlights Patek Philippe's ability to seamlessly blend different horological styles. The Nautilus moonphase models command a significant price, reflecting their desirability and the intricate craftsmanship involved. The slightly elevated price compared to other Nautilus models showcases the added complexity and prestige of the lunar phase mechanism. These watches are a testament to Patek Philippe's ability to maintain the iconic design language of the Nautilus while incorporating complex functions flawlessly.
